diff --git a/apps/dav/lib/Connector/Sabre/AnonymousOptionsPlugin.php b/apps/dav/lib/Connector/Sabre/AnonymousOptionsPlugin.php index b693b50f8e..63e5773597 100644 --- a/apps/dav/lib/Connector/Sabre/AnonymousOptionsPlugin.php +++ b/apps/dav/lib/Connector/Sabre/AnonymousOptionsPlugin.php @@ -75,7 +75,7 @@ class AnonymousOptionsPlugin extends ServerPlugin { // setup a fake tree for anonymous access $this->server->tree = new Tree(new Directory('')); $corePlugin->httpOptions($request, $response); - $this->server->emit('afterMethod', [$request, $response]); + $this->server->emit('afterMethod:*', [$request, $response]); $this->server->emit('afterMethod:OPTIONS', [$request, $response]); $this->server->sapi->sendResponse($response); diff --git a/apps/dav/lib/Connector/Sabre/LockPlugin.php b/apps/dav/lib/Connector/Sabre/LockPlugin.php index a8e3818c5c..7c07f45fc7 100644 --- a/apps/dav/lib/Connector/Sabre/LockPlugin.php +++ b/apps/dav/lib/Connector/Sabre/LockPlugin.php @@ -47,7 +47,7 @@ class LockPlugin extends ServerPlugin { public function initialize(\Sabre\DAV\Server $server) { $this->server = $server; $this->server->on('beforeMethod:*', [$this, 'getLock'], 50); - $this->server->on('afterMethod', [$this, 'releaseLock'], 50); + $this->server->on('afterMethod:*', [$this, 'releaseLock'], 50); } public function getLock(RequestInterface $request) {